
The M25 has been closed after a crash between a lorry and a tanker. Drivers are being warned to expect major delays between Junction 5 and 7.
National Highways says the tanker, which was transporting waste, "overturned and ruptured" following the crash. It caused oil, diesel and waste to spill on the carriageway.
The crash was first reported at 4.14am on Wednesday morning and the road is expected to remain closed throughoutt the morning. Drivers are being urged to avoid the area and find alternative routes.
